Football fever is an at all-time high with fans waiting for the match between the two teams, Philadelphia Eagles and New York Giants to begin soon. And it’s not just football fans who are vouching for their favorite teams, but people from tennis are also excited for this showdown.

Just recently, the partners of both tennis players Tommy Paul and Frances Tiafoe took to social media to support and cheer for their teams. They are both supporting the Philadelphia Eagles in today’s match, with predictions in the Birds’ favor.

Tommy Paul is dating Paige Lorenze and Frances Tiafoe is dating Ayan Broomfield. In one of the recent posts on her official Instagram account, Broomfield shared how she is supporting the Philadelphia Eagles. She was seen wearing the jersey of the team and also made a video cheering for them.

In the same post, under the comment section, Paige Lorenze mentioned, “We love the @philadelphiaeagles.” It clearly shows that both of them are supporting this team for their match today against the New York Giants, rooting for the City of Brotherly Love.

How are Tommy Paul and Frances Tiafoe looking for the 2024 season?

Tommy Paul started off last season well but faltered in the second half. On the other hand, Frances Tiafoe lost his way in the Hong King Open as he was defeated by JC Shang on the 5 of January.

Besides that, another thing that did not go in the favor of these players is that they were both dropped from the list of the Davis Cup team for 2024. Since Team USA did not see a good result by keeping the team for the 2023 tournament, they decided to ditch them for the next season.
